弹性伸缩架构
腾讯云通过弹性伸缩(AS)服务实现资源动态扩展,支持根据CPU利用率、网络流量等指标自动扩展云服务器(CVM)实例数量。当检测到流量激增时,系统可在5分钟内完成横向扩容,最高可支撑千万级并发请求。
关键组件包括:
- 负载均衡CLB:智能分配流量至多个可用区
- 自动扩缩策略:预设阈值触发资源调整
- 竞价实例混部:降低突发流量处理成本
全局流量调度
采用Anycast技术实现全球流量智能路由,通过DNS解析将用户请求导向最近节点。结合内容分发网络(CDN)将静态资源缓存至全球1300+边缘节点,降低源站压力达70%。
场景 | 响应延迟 | 带宽消耗 |
---|---|---|
未使用CDN | 220ms | 1.2Gbps |
启用CDN | 35ms | 0.3Gbps |
数据缓存优化
通过多级缓存体系降低数据库访问压力:
- 客户端本地缓存高频访问数据
- Redis集群缓存会话数据和热点内容
- Memcached缓存数据库查询结果集
采用对象存储COS存储海量静态文件,配合数据压缩技术减少30%网络传输量。
数据库性能提升
通过分布式数据库TDSQL实现:
- 读写分离:主库处理写操作,从库处理读操作
- 分库分表:将单表数据拆分至多个物理节点
- SQL优化引擎:自动重构低效查询语句
实测显示该方案使QPS提升8倍,事务处理延迟降低至5ms以内。
安全防护体系
构建多层防御机制保障高并发场景稳定性:
- DDoS防护:提供T级清洗能力
- Web应用防火墙:拦截恶意请求
- 流量整形:智能识别异常流量特征
结合实时监控系统,可在50ms内触发防御策略。
腾讯云通过弹性架构、智能调度、缓存优化、数据库集群和安全防护的协同运作,形成完整的高并发处理体系。实际测试表明,该方案可支撑百万级并发用户访问,在电商大促、在线教育等场景中保持99.99%的可用性。